Entitlement Training Opportunities
There is no charge for these activities. Please note that Entitlement does not necessarily mean the activity is for every school, some of the activities provide differentiated support to specifically targeted schools.
Examples of entitlement activities include those that are -
- Funded through a specific local or national grants
e.g. NGfL, Drugs Strategy, Teenage Pregnancy Strategy, Health Promoting Schools
- Part of the national Primary and Secondary Strategies
- National priorities such as Underachievement - Gender Issues,
- Local priorities such as Behaviour Support Plan, SEN Plan
- Learning for All etc.
- An activity for supporting identified schools causing concern identified in line with the LA - Schools Code of Practice.
- Induction of newly appointed Heads and Deputies
- Support for NQTs (Induction Programme)
- Annual Primary Headteachers’, Deputies and Assistant Headteachers’ Conference
- Annual Secondary Headteachers’ Conference
- Annual Secondary Deputy Headteachers’ Conference
- Termly briefings and day conferences for Primary Headteachers
- Entitlement documents produced by Wirral LA
